# Height Ratio and Front-Road Review
## Overview
This skill evaluates Taiwan building-height limits commonly referred to in
practice as "height ratio" review.
For non-FAR-control contexts, or when Article 166 does not exclude the height
limit, the common front-road-width rule is Building Technical Regulations,
Design & Construction volume (建築技術規則建築設計施工編) Article 14:
```text
maximum building height = adopted front road width x 1.5 + 6 m
```
For FAR-control areas, Chapter 9 applies. The practical "1:3.6" / "3.6"
height-slope review comes from Article 164:
```text
H <= 3.6 x (Sw + D)
As <= L x Sw / 2
```
In current practice, most common urban-planned building sites are FAR-control
areas. In those cases, Article 166 usually excludes Article 14(1)'s
`1.5W + 6m` height-limit part and the under-7m-frontage 9 m height cap. Do not
apply those as primary height limits in FAR-control reviews. Still use Article
14(1) to determine `Sw` for Article 164.
Invoke this skill when:
- A project needs a building-height or front-road-width review
- A FAR-control-area Article 164 height-slope or road-shadow-area review is
needed
- The site fronts multiple roads, a designated existing lane, a private passage,
a planned roundabout, a road-end condition, a greenbelt, a river, or permanent
open space
- Floor-area boundary lines vary by floor or mass, requiring conservative
control-point selection
- Residential-zone, non-FAR-area, cross-zoning, or local height limits may also
control the result
- A permit memo must explain which road width, which article, and which control
point were used
Do not stop at a single formula. The legally important questions are which width
may be recognized as the front road width, which article applies, and whether a
more conservative floor-area-line control point governs the result.

## Article Coverage
| Article | Topic | Use in review |
|---|---|---|
| Art. 1 | Definitions | Building height, site ground, road, private passage, similar passage, permanent open space, floor area, setback depth |
| Art. 8 | Existing lanes | Existing-lane frontage and wider-road corner-lot exception |
| Art. 14 | Base height ratio | `H <= 1.5W + 6m` where not excluded; front-road width recognition cases for `Sw` |
| Art. 15 | Permanent open space | Height limits when the site touches or faces permanent open space |
| Art. 16 | Multiple roads | Depth-zone method for sites fronting two or more roads |
| Art. 17 | Deleted | No current substantive rule |
| Art. 18 | Deleted | No current substantive rule |
| Art. 19 | Road end | Dead-end frontage rule and wider-road exception |
| Art. 23 | Residential zone | 21 m / 7-story cap and exceptions |
| Art. 24 | Non-FAR-control area | 36 m / 12-story cap and exceptions |
| Art. 27 | Added height and open space | Extra open-space rule; still cannot exceed Section 3 height limits where applicable |
| Art. 29 | Cross-zoning site | Height must be calculated separately by zoning district |
| Art. 160 | FAR-control areas | FAR-control-area design follows Chapter 9 unless urban-plan rules say otherwise |
| Art. 164 | 3.6:1 height slope | `H <= 3.6(Sw + D)`, road-shadow-area limit, and opposite-road-boundary cap |
| Art. 166 | FAR-control exclusions | Art. 14(1) height-limit part, Arts. 15, 23, 26, 27, etc. do not apply to FAR-control areas |

## Review Algorithm
1. Determine the legal nature of every frontage.
- Article 1 roads include legally announced roads and existing lanes with
designated building line.
- Private passages and similar passages are not roads unless a specific rule
treats them as a front road for height review.
2. Confirm the building height being tested.
- Use Article 1's building-height definition.
- Flag roof projections, parapets, roof equipment, non-flat roofs, and site
ground differences for separate Article 1 review.
3. Decide whether Chapter 9 FAR-control-area rules govern.
- If the site is in a FAR-control area, Article 160 points to Chapter 9
unless urban-plan law or plan text says otherwise.
- Article 166 excludes Article 14(1)'s height-limit part, Article 15,
Article 23, Article 26, and Article 27 from FAR-control areas.
- In common current urban-planned projects, assume FAR-control is likely
until checked. If confirmed, do not use `1.5W + 6m` or the under-7m 9 m
cap as primary height limits unless a separate urban-plan, local, or
authority requirement says so.
- In FAR-control areas, run Article 164 and still flag stricter urban-plan or
local rules.
4. Apply Article 14 where applicable.
- If Article 166 excludes the Article 14 height-limit part, do not run
`H <= 1.5W + 6m` as a governing height cap.
- Still use Article 14(1)'s front-road-width recognition rules to determine
`Sw` for Article 164.
- Normal frontage: use front road width.
- Wall line: measure road width to the wall line.
- Planned roundabout: use the widest road intersecting the roundabout, then
check Article 16 if another side also fronts a road.
- Private passage used as main access to the building line: treat it as the
front road, but if wider than the connected road, use the connected road
width.
- Private passage left inside a site touching the building line: apply
Article 16(1) to the portion near the building line; apply Article 14(3) to
the remaining portion.
- Road separated by greenbelt or river: combine both road widths, capped at
twice the width of the road directly touching the site.
5. Add the under-7m road rule only where Article 14's height-limit part applies.
- If adopted front road width is under 7 m, the building height within 3.5 m
from the road centerline is capped at 9 m.
- In FAR-control areas, this cap is usually excluded by Article 166 together
with Article 14(1)'s height-limit part.
6. Run Article 164 in FAR-control-area reviews as one integrated geometry
check.
- Establish the front road, building line, opposite front-road boundary,
projection direction perpendicular to the building line, `Sw`, and `L`.
- Use `Sw` based on Article 14(1)'s front-road-width recognition rules.
- Mark the floor-area boundary line for each tested floor or mass.
- For `D`, use the conservative control point on the floor-area boundary
line: the closest / outermost point facing the building line for the
building part being tested.
- Pair that control point with the corresponding building-part height `H`.
- Check height by `H <= 3.6(Sw + D)`.
- Project each tested building part at the 3.6:1 slope in the direction
perpendicular to the building line and calculate the road-shadow area `As`
falling on the front road.
- Check `As <= L x Sw / 2`.
- Confirm the shadow maximum does not exceed the opposite front-road
boundary.
- If the opposite side of the front road has legally confirmed permanent
open space, the allowable shadow area may be doubled.
- If floor-area boundary lines vary by floor, bend, curve, or step back, test
all relevant outer points and use the smallest `D`, largest `As`, or
strictest result.
7. Check Article 15 permanent open space where not excluded by Article 166.
- Opposite-side permanent open space: height is capped by
`(road width + open-space depth) x 1.5`, and also by
`widest road width x 2 + 6 m`.
- Site touching surrounding permanent open space: open-space width and depth
or depth sum must reach 20 m; height is capped by
`widest road width x 2 + 6 m`.
- Partial frontage/facing: only the matching extension zone, up to 30 m,
benefits from the rule.
- If Article 14(5) also applies, use the wider applicable result.
8. Check Article 16 multiple-road zoning.
- Zone from the widest road boundary: depth `2 x Wmax`, capped at 30 m, uses
the widest road.
- Outside that zone, within 10 m from other road centerlines, the next-road
zone uses depth `2 x Wnext`, capped at 30 m; repeat in road-width order.
- Remaining area outside the first two categories uses the widest road.
- Compute height separately for each zone.
- For four-frontage sites, use the `B`, `B1`, `B2`, `B3`, `B4` workflow in
the Article 16 method below.
9. Check Article 19 road-end condition.
- If the site touches a road end, use that road width as the front road.
- If another side touches a wider road, height is not limited by the road-end
width; continue with the wider-road analysis.
10. Check related height restrictions.
- Article 8: if the site touches an existing lane but also touches a wider
road and is a corner lot, height is not limited by the existing-lane width.
- Article 23: residential-zone buildings are generally capped at 21 m and 7
stories unless the road-width/open-space exceptions apply; over 36 m also
requires Article 24 review.
- Article 24: non-FAR-control areas are generally capped at 36 m and 12
stories unless the listed site, road, and open-space conditions apply.
- Article 27: added stories/height may require added open space where
applicable, and cannot exceed Section 3 height limits where applicable.
- Article 29: if the site crosses multiple zoning districts, calculate height
separately by district.
- Always flag stricter urban-plan, zoning, local-government, special-use, and
special-building rules.
11. Output the conclusion.
- State evidence, adopted width, applicable article, control point, formula,
height cap, proposed height, result, and any authority-confirmation item.

## Key Formulas
```text
Article 14 base:
Hmax = Wfront x 1.5 + 6 m
Use only where Article 14's height-limit part is not excluded by Article 166.
```
```text
Article 14 under-7m frontage:
Within 3.5 m from the road centerline, Hmax = 9 m
Usually excluded in FAR-control areas by Article 166.
```
```text
Article 15 opposite permanent open space:
Hmax <= (road width + permanent open-space depth) x 1.5
Hmax <= widest road width x 2 + 6 m
```
```text
Article 15 surrounding permanent open space:
If open-space width and depth/depth-sum >= 20 m,
Hmax <= widest road width x 2 + 6 m
```
```text
Article 164 FAR-control-area height slope:
H <= 3.6 x (Sw + D)
As <= L x Sw / 2
```
```text
Article 164 shadow-depth quick check:
horizontal projection depth from control point = H / 3.6
road-shadow depth ~= max(0, H / 3.6 - D)
```
When conservative office-standard review is requested, measure `D` from the
outermost floor-area boundary line control point facing the building line.

## Conservative Article 164 Control-Point Method
Use this method when the user says the office reviews from the strictest point,
or when floor-area boundary lines vary by point:
1. Extract each floor or mass floor-area boundary line.
2. Find the side facing the relevant building line.
3. Mark every turn point, curve tangent, local protrusion, and closest point to
the building line.
4. Measure `D` from each candidate point toward the building line, in the
direction used for Article 164's perpendicular projection to the building
line.
5. Pair each control point with that building part's `H`.
6. Use the smallest `D`, lowest `3.6(Sw + D)`, or most unfavorable
exceedance as the controlling result.
Do not use average distance, centroid distance, the most recessed point, or the
largest setback to increase allowed height.
---
## Article 16 Four-Frontage Method
Use this method when a site fronts four roads or when the user describes the
whole site as `B` and asks how to identify front-road control areas.
The plain-language rule is: give the widest road first priority, then treat the
remaining area controlled by the other roads as an undecided pool. Do not assign
`B3` or `B4` before `B2` is calculated. `B2` first takes from the undecided
pool; then `B3` takes from what remains; the final remainder becomes `B4`.
1. Name the whole site `B`.
2. Sort all frontage roads by width: `W1 > W2 > W3 > W4`.
3. From the `W1` road boundary or building line, offset into the site by
`min(2W1, 30 m)`.
4. Assign that first area to `B1`.
5. Define the remaining site as `B - B1`.
6. Inside `B - B1`, use the 10 m road-centerline zones of `W2`, `W3`, and `W4`
to identify the undecided pool `U` that may be governed by the other roads.
7. Any part of `B - B1` outside `U` returns to `B1` under Article 16's
remaining-area rule.
8. Keep `U` undecided. Do not pre-assign it to `B2`, `B3`, and `B4`.
9. For `W2`, offset from the `W2` road boundary or building line by
`min(2W2, 30 m)`. The portion of `U` reached by that offset becomes `B2`.
This may consume area that visually seems like future `B3` or `B4`, because
those areas are not yet decided.
10. Define the remaining undecided pool as `U - B2`.
11. For `W3`, offset from the `W3` road boundary or building line by
`min(2W3, 30 m)`. The portion of `U - B2` reached by that offset becomes
`B3`; this may cut into the area that would otherwise remain for `B4`.
12. Assign the final remaining undecided area to `B4`.
13. Use each final area with its own front road: `B1 -> W1`, `B2 -> W2`,
`B3 -> W3`, `B4 -> W4`.
Practical output should show the whole site `B`, road-width order, the
undecided pool `U`, areas returned to `B1`, the sequential `min(2W, 30 m)`
offset cuts for `B2` and `B3`, and the final `B1` through `B4` boundaries.
---
## Article 164 Road-Shadow-Area Method
Treat the road-shadow-area review as part of the same Article 164 geometry, not
as a detached checklist.
1. Confirm the front road, building line, opposite road boundary, `Sw`, and `L`.
2. Confirm the projection direction perpendicular to the building line.
3. Mark each tested floor-area boundary line and its conservative control
point.
4. Measure `D` from the control point to the building line and pair it with
that building part's `H`.
5. Use `H / 3.6 - D` as a quick check for whether the projected shadow enters
the front road, but do not use it as a substitute for area calculation.
6. Draw or calculate the 3.6:1 projection onto the front road and compute `As`.
7. Check both limits:
- `H <= 3.6(Sw + D)`
- `As <= L x Sw / 2`
8. Confirm no shadow extends beyond the opposite front-road boundary.
9. If claiming shadow-area doubling, verify the opposite-side permanent open
space under the legal definition before using `As <= L x Sw`.
If the height formula passes but `As` fails, or if `As` passes but the projection
extends past the opposite road boundary, the Article 164 result is still not
clean.

## Decision Checklist
| Question | Why it matters |
|---|---|
| Is each frontage a legal road, designated existing lane, private passage, or similar passage? | Article 1 controls the baseline classification. |
| Is the site in a FAR-control area? | Article 160 points to Chapter 9 and Article 166 usually excludes Article 14 height limits, including `1.5W + 6m` and the under-7m 9 m cap. |
| Is a wall line designated? | Article 14 measures road width to the wall line. |
| Does the site face a planned roundabout? | Article 14 uses the widest road intersecting the roundabout. |
| Is main access through a private passage? | Article 14 may treat it as the front road, capped by connected road width. |
| Is there a greenbelt or river between roadways? | Article 14 allows combined width, capped at twice the directly adjacent road width. |
| Does the site front more than one road? | Article 16 creates depth zones. |
| Does the site face or touch permanent open space? | Article 15 may change the height limit and applicable area, unless excluded by Article 166. |
| Is the adopted road width under 7 m? | Article 14 adds a 9 m cap in the 3.5 m centerline zone only when Article 14's height-limit part is not excluded by Article 166. |
| Is the road a dead end? | Article 19 controls unless another side touches a wider road. |
| Is the site in a residential zone or non-FAR-control area? | Articles 23 and 24 may impose separate caps. |
| Does the site cross zoning districts? | Article 29 requires separate calculation. |
| Does Article 164 apply? | Test `H`, `D`, `Sw`, `As`, and the opposite road boundary. |
| Which floor-area-line point is most conservative? | Use the closest / outermost point to the building line, not average or maximum setback. |
| Is the opposite front-road boundary shown? | Article 164 requires the shadow maximum not to exceed that boundary. |
| Was `As` calculated from the projected road shadow? | Passing `H <= 3.6(Sw + D)` alone does not complete Article 164 review. |
| Is opposite-side permanent open space legally confirmed? | Article 164 shadow-area doubling depends on this condition. |
---
## Common Pitfalls
- Using actual pavement width without checking building-line designation or
urban-plan road width.
- Treating a private passage or similar passage as a road without an Article 14
basis.
- Applying Article 14, Article 15, or Article 23 in a FAR-control area without
checking Article 166.
- Treating `1.5W + 6m` or the under-7m 9 m cap as the governing height limit in
a FAR-control area, instead of switching to Article 164.
- Running Article 164 with average setback, largest setback, inner wall line, or
centroid distance instead of the outermost floor-area-line control point.
- Using one `D` for the whole building when different floors or masses have
different floor-area boundary lines and heights.
- Applying the widest road to the whole site even though Article 16 requires
depth-zone review.
- Combining road widths across a greenbelt or river but forgetting the two-times
direct-frontage cap.
- Forgetting the 9 m cap when the adopted front road width is under 7 m and
Article 14 applies.
- Treating permanent open space as simple road widening without Article 15's
depth, width, partial-application, and cap checks.
- Reviewing residential-zone buildings only by `1.5W + 6m` and missing Article
23 where it applies.
- Running only `H <= 3.6(Sw + D)` and forgetting the Article 164
road-shadow-area check `As`.
- Treating a passing `As` value as sufficient when the projected shadow still
exceeds the opposite front-road boundary.
- Doubling Article 164 allowable shadow area without legally confirming
opposite-side permanent open space.
- Ignoring cross-zoning, local urban-plan text, or stricter local rules.
